Hester “Esther”, daughter of John Bond and Hester Blakely, was born in September 1655 in Newbury, Essex, Massachusetts Bay Colony. The various sources have two different birth dates – September 3 [1] and September 25.[2] It is unknown which is correct, but the records are mostly in chronological order and Hester’s birth is listed after a birth of a child on September 13.

Esther was married in Newbury about 1673 to Aquila Chase II, son of Aquila Chase and Anna Wheeler Chase. No marriage record has been found.

Esther’s husband, Aquila, “…was a husbandman and inherited his father’s homestead on North Atkinson street in what is now Newburyport.” [3]

Children of Aquila and Esther, all born in Newbury:

  • 1. Esther, b. 18 Nov. 1674, married Daniel Merrill. Jan. 15, 1674. [4]
  • 2. Joseph, b. 25 March 1677, married Abigail Thurston. [4]
  • 3. Anne, b. 4 June 1679, married Abraham Folsom. [4]
  • 4. Priscilla, b. 15 Oct. 1681, married Joseph Hills. [4]
  • 5. Jemima, b. ____, married Peter Ordway.
  • 6. Hannah, b. about 1687, married Joseph Hoyt. (Estimated from age at time of death.)
  • 7. Abigail, b. about 1690, married Joseph Robinson.
  • 8. Benjamin, b. about 1691, married Sarah Bayley.
  • 9. Rebecca, b. about 1694, married first Jonathan Moulton, second Robert Savory. (Estimated from age at time of death.)

After Aquila’s death in 1720, “Esther Chase, widow and Joseph Chase son of Aquila Chase of Newbury dec’d, were appointed administrators of the estate of Aquila……”[3] It is unknown exactly when Esther died, but on 8 July 1723 she signed (with an ‘X’) Aguila’s probate papers.


Brief Biography

Sergeant Aquila was born in Newbury (now known as Newbury Port), Massachusetts, the son of Aquila Chase (Sr.) and Ann Wheeler. Sgt. Aquila and his six sisters and four brothers were of the first generation of Chase's to be born in the United States, as their father, Aquila Chase, Sr., and his Brother Thomas, who were born in England, are believed to be the first Chase's to immigrate to America, in about 1640.

Sgt. Aquila married Esther Bond (dau. of John Bond and Esther Blakeley) in 1673 in Newbury, where they raised nine children: Esther, b. 1674, Joseph, b. 1677, Anne, b. 1679, Priscilla, b. 1681, Rebecca, b. 1684, Jemina, b. about 1687, Hannah, b. 1689, Abigail, b. about 1690, and Benjamin, b. about 1692.

He was a farmer and inherited his father's homestead on North Atkinson St. in Newbury Port.

He was chosen to be a "fence viewer" (town official who administered fence laws and settled property line disputes) at the upper end of Newbury March 18, 1683/4 and took the oath of allegiance in 1678.

He was a member of the town committee Dec. 12, 1702, and a soldier under the command of Capt. Thomas Noyes in 1688. Later he was sergeant of that company. He also owned many acres of salt marsh by the Plum Island River which was known as "Chase Island".

Sgt. Aquila Chase died 29 July, 1729, in Newbury, MA.

(Source: Seven Generations The Descendants of Aquila and Thomas Chase)

Chase" Salmon Portland Chase (1808-1873) was a member of Abraham Lincoln's "Team of Rivals". He was an overly ambitious, pompous and self-serving man who usually chose to further his own aspirations for fame over serving Lincoln (see Doris Kearns Goodwin's book, Team of Rivals ). He served as Lincoln's Sec of Treasury during the Civil War. Lincoln later named him to the post of Chief Justice of the Supreme Court. I had a hunch that the Chase members of our family tree might be related to Salmon Chase and, indeed they were. Salmon's father, Ithamar (1762-1817) is the son of Dudley (1730-1814) who is the son of Samuel (1707-1800) who is the son of Moses (1663-1743). Moses is the brother of our Thomas Chase. Thomas and Moses were the sons of Aquila Chase of Chesham, England [origins not yet proven]. Aquila is the first member of the Chase family to emigrate from England to New England in 1640.
